Accenti Magazine Writing Contest

The topic is open. Any type of entry that meets the submission criteria below is eligible. Multiple entries welcome.

• The contest is open to prose works.
• Entries can be fiction, non-fiction or creative non-fiction.
• Entries must be previously unpublished and not under consideration by any other publication.
• Entries must be original and not a translation of a previously published work.
• Maximum length: 2000 words.
• No poetry, plays, reviews, and scholarly essays.
No footnotes and endnotes. No pseudonyms.
• Submissions must be in Word or txt format.
• No email or fax submissions.

• Submissions must be in English.
• Submissions can be an English translation of the author's unpublished original work in another language.
• The contest is open to all writers, established and emerging, worldwide.


Submission Info

Prize Info

  • First Prize: $1000.00 (CDN) and publication in Accenti.

  • Additional Information: Three runner-up prizes: $100.00 (CDN) each and publication in Accenti.
